1. What Does Design Have to Do with Your Ride?

It’s not only good looking to design a scooter, it will affect handling, comfort, and life in a big way. Well-designed scooters will provide a better ride as well as handling. Design elements that one must look at are:

  • Wheel Size: Wheels bigger than 10 inches provide better traction, stability, and comfort and are most effectively used on rough roads. Wheels between 5 and 8 inches, while more responsive, may sacrifice ride quality.
  • Tire Type: Pneumatic air-filled tires provide a rougher ride with improved suspension, but it requires more maintenance. Airless solid tires are flat-proof but provide a harsher ride.
  • Suspension System: Hydraulic/air piston, spring, or rubber suspension systems are used in scooters. A combination of hydraulic and spring is the most comfortable, especially for long use.
  • Braking Mechanism: Brakes are extremely safety-sensitive. Disc brakes provide much higher power to stop a vehicle, and electric brakes provide lower maintenance regenerative braking.
  • Safety Features: Minimum safety features include front and rear lighting to be seen and an Ingress Protection (IP) rating to prevent exposure of the scooter to water and dust.

2. What’s the Role of Speed in Your Commute?

Maximum speed of electric scooter is among the most significant things to remember, particularly for commuters. The majority of scooters will be between 20 and 30 mph but actual performance will depend on rider weight, terrain, and efficiency of the motor.

  • Commuting Needs: If you have a predominantly bike-lane commute or heavy traffic, a mid-speed scooter (15–25 mph) would do. But if your commute involves hills or open spaces, then a quicker model would be more convenient.
  • Laws: Depending on the locality, electric scooters are either governed by speed limitations. Choose a model which meets local regulations and does not demand the application for a special license.
  • Safety Precautions: Regardless of high or low speeds, there should be employed a safe safety kit, such as a helmet, gloves, and knee pads, to prevent chances of getting hurt.

3. How Much Motor Power Do You Need

Motor power has a major impact on the speed of an electric scooter, especially on hills and uneven roads. Brushless DC motors are universal in most scooters, whether double-motor scooters or single-motor scooters.

Standard Models: Casual cruising and flat riding is optimally suited with 250W of motor power.

Average Performance: Bumpy roads and sloping roads are optimally suited to 400–500W of motor power.

High-Performance Models: Speed devils or hill ascenders demand top power and acceleration, which 1,000W and above twin-motor scooters provide.

5. What Range Do You Need for Your Trips

Range of an electric scooter is how far a scooter can go on one full charge. Ranges differ based on many factors like battery size, motor power, rider weight, and road surface.

  • Short Trips (5–10 miles):Small battery (36V, 7Ah) would be sufficient.
  • Medium Rides (10–20 miles): 48V, 10Ah batteries will be range-providing units.
  • Medium Rides:Long-Range Commuting (20+ miles): Higher capacity battery scooters (52V, 18Ah+) will be range-extended but heavier.

Factory ranges, quoted by manufacturers, are calculated in perfect conditions but real-world usage is different. To prevent range anxiety, opt for a larger range model for your daily commute.
